What is a Medicare Supplement Plan… And Why Do I Need One?
A Medicare Supplement plan is additional insurance that works in conjunction with Medicare Part A and Medicare Part B benefits. There are 10 standardized plans, A to N. What is Medigap?
Medigap is Medicare’s terminology for private insurance that covers the gaps between your traditional Medicare benefits and what you must pay out of pocket. What Medicare Out-of-Pocket Costs Mean to You
Out-of-pocket costs are those fees that you have to pay at the doctors office, hospital or pharmacy because they are not covered by your Medicare health insurance.
